I live in louisiana and my fiancee wants me to insure his car.?
What risk are there for insuring his car? Could I be sued?
                     
 




Answer Man
Technically, you can not insure another person's vehicle on your policy. You must have an "insurable interest" in the vehicle. Which means that you must be an owner of the vehicle to have it on your policy.

But, if you lie to your agent and tell him you are the owner of the vehicle and your boy friend will just be driving your car, you could lose a good driver discount if he has an accident or ticket.

A few corrections to previous answers. You can get liability insurance for this vehicle, even if you don't own it. Your insurable interest in this case is the fact that you would be driving the vehicle and thus be liable for any damage caused as a result of any accident you caused. However, if you are living in the same household and you insure the vehicle in your name only and he is in an accident with it there may be no coverage, depending upon how thorough of an investigation the insurance company does.
